Welcome to the Stormline team. The weather-alert fan-out service consumes events from the Skywatch ingest queue and dispatches notifications per-region through the Relay tier. Review the dedupe logic in the fan-out worker first; it's where most regressions land. Staging credentials come from your onboarding buddy. For questions about review standards or merge policy, contact the service lead.

alerts address for kajog-tadup: druox@plorvanet.internal

## Runbook: Refreshing the Driftwood static-analysis baseline

Driftwood's analyzer compares every build against a committed baseline file so legacy findings don't block merges. Only refresh the baseline after a deliberate cleanup sprint, never to silence new findings. Regenerate it on a clean checkout, review the diff with a second engineer, and land it in its own commit. The regeneration script must be run with the following configuration values.

settings of tagef-bawif:
DRUIX_HOST=druix.zemvarlabs.internal
DRUIX_PORT=8000

## Deploying the Gatewick Proctor Queue

Deploys are pretty painless: push to main, wait for the pipeline, then watch the queue drain dashboard for five minutes. If candidates pile up mid-exam, roll back first and ask questions later — the queue replays safely. Everything the workers care about lives in one config block, shown here for reference.

settings of bafof-yagef:
JOROX_PIN=8740
JOROX_TENANT=pelox
JOROX_METRICS_HOST=metrics.jorox.qorvelworks.internal
JOROX_SEAL=seal_c78f63c1
JOROX_STANDBY_TEAM=norax

# Who to Contact — DedupeOwl

New to the team? Welcome! DedupeOwl is our on-call alert deduplicator — it collapses duplicate pages so nobody gets woken up five times for the same broken cache. If DedupeOwl itself misbehaves (alerts leaking through, or worse, getting swallowed), don't just shrug and silence things. First check the #owl-status dashboard, then ping whoever's on the rotation. For rule tuning requests or "why did my alert get deduped?" questions, Marit on the Signals team is your best bet. You can reach her directly below.

escalation mailbox, bafog-fafog: ulador@paliqlabs.internal